About Britam Holdings's Workforce

Britam Holdings Plc (BRIT) is a Financial Services company that employs 1,913 people worldwide as of March 2026. It is the 9th-largest by headcount among its peers. Founded in 1995, the company is head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ya and trades on the Nairobi Stock Exchange.

Britam Holdings's workforce has grown 41.4% from 2023 to 2026, up 19.9% year over year in 2026. Its workforce is concentrated most in Kenya (80.1%), followed by Uganda (7.0%) and Mozambique (3.9%), with Kenya, its fastest-growing location, up 10.7%.

Britam Holdings's largest functional groups are Finance and Operations (66.7%), Engineering (21.2%), and Sales and Marketing (12.1%), with Sales and Marketing growing fastest (up 11.8%). Median employee tenure is 3.1 years. The average salary is $10,921, ranging from a median of $63,000 in Northern America to $8,000 in Sub-Saharan Africa.

Britam Holdings's active job postings rose 58.3% in 2026 to 31, with new postings per month cooling from 34 in 2023 to 31 in 2026. Overall employee sentiment is positive and improving.
